Here is a list of some events happened on May 11. For full list please click on the link above.
Date | Event |
---|---|
1894 | Four thousand Pullman Palace Car Company workers go on a wildcat strike. |
1970 | The 1970 Lubbock tornado kills 26 and causes $250 million in damage. |
1813 | William Lawson, Gregory Blaxland and William Wentworth discover a route across the Blue Mountains, opening up inland Australia to settlement. |
1997 | Deep Blue, a chess-playing supercomputer, defeats Garry Kasparov in the last game of the rematch, becoming the first computer to beat a world-champion chess player in a classic match format. |
1996 | After the aircraft's departure from Miami, a fire started by improperly handled chemical oxygen generators in the cargo hold of Atlanta-bound ValuJet Airlines Flight 592 causes the Douglas DC-9 to crash in the Florida Everglades, killing all 110 on board. |
1919 | Uruguay becomes a signatory to the Buenos Aires copyright treaty. |
1889 | An attack upon a U.S. Army paymaster and escort results in the theft of over $28,000 and the award of two Medals of Honor. |
2014 | Fifteen people are killed and 46 injured in Kinshasa in a stampede caused by tear gas being thrown into soccer stands by police officers. |
2016 | One hundred and ten people are killed in an ISIL bombing in Baghdad. |
1998 | India conducts three underground atomic tests in Pokhran. |
